Zero Networks Expands Global Partner Ecosystem with Channel-Focused Growth Strategy

Zero Networks announced continued expansion of its global partner ecosystem, highlighting accelerated growth in channel engagement and a high-velocity go-to-market model centered on partners. The company has built a global partner engine designed to drive faster customer acquisition and broader adoption of its identity-based segmentation and lateral movement protection platform. The update to the Zero to Sixty partner program features a new tier structure rewarding investment, revamped discounting, enhanced sales, marketing development and a modernized partner portal. This update grow momentum across the enterprise ecosystem benefitting MSPs, enterprise VARs and offers global distribution.

Zero Networks' partner program emphasizes enablement, streamlined deal registration, and joint marketing initiatives to accelerate deployment cycles. As cyber resilience becomes a board-level priority, channel-centric security models are emerging as a key pathway for vendors to scale globally while helping partners address escalating breach risks. Zero Networks offers scalable, identity-first foundation for limiting business disruption with its partner ecosystem.
